Lee I agree, the yield stress reflects the max for design, you want to keep the stress in the elastic region. Typically Yield increases proportionally as UTS increases, e.g., a Columbus Niobium tube has a UTS = 152 to 167 ksi with a Yield = 107 ksi. The Columbus has a 55% higher yield and
